Hi guys, it has been 2 yrs already and I am back to the boards for some advice.
I am going ahead with my application for the Tier 1 visa under the PBS. I already have an HSMP which expires Mar 2010. I have a date for Dec 2009 for an in-person application.
My application pack includes.
1. Application Form
2. Fresh new photos
3. Covering Letter
4. Proof of Income
a. 10 months bank statements with the salary credit clearly highlighted
b. Letter from employer with details of monthly gross and net salary for the last 10 months.
c. Pay slips, with company stamp. Now THERE might be an issue as I dont seem to have a couple of my pay slips. I am trying to get duplicates here. Do you think there will be a problem considering I am providing 2 other income proofs.
5. Bank statements for an ISA account with £2800 balance for last 6 months. Is this acceptable????
Do i need to provide my IELTS score and masters certificate?? I have a Masters from a Uk university? I had provided this info in my original HSMP application.
Look forward to your replys! As always help and advice on TIER 1 is sincerely appreciated! Cheers

Please make sure the funds of 800 GBP is maintained on each and every day of those 3months and make sure this amount is not even less by 1pence.. HO is very strict on this..
Bankstatements sent to ur home address (originals ) are accepted no need to get them signed or letter is required.. if they are original
